Output 38e7660d16dfd884aec18a0c1489a949aa9bb14c63ce7edba7d1d7f6e2ee41f9:0

value
17700
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4038ea248f89c4582fcdea5cff3091a153097993c4fb254e650f57e242ec6eae
address
tb1pgquw5fy038z9st7dafw07vy359fsj7vncnaj2nn9pat7yshvd6hq3d0zwk
transaction
38e7660d16dfd884aec18a0c1489a949aa9bb14c63ce7edba7d1d7f6e2ee41f9
confirmations
42379
spent
true